Search this site
Embedded Files
Skip to main content
Skip to navigation
IBSI TAX SERVICES
Home
Locations
About Us
IBSI TAX SERVICES
Home
Locations
About Us
More
Home
Locations
About Us
Locations
Home Office
195 Dawkins Loop Road Chattahoochee, FL 32324
Main Office
15 South Madison Street Quincy, FL 32351
Google Sites
Report abuse
Page details
Page updated
Google Sites
Report abuse